Tim Brett.

Stood for Liberal Democrats in North East Fife at the 2015 General Election. Not elected — so there is no parliamentary record to show, but here is the contest in full and where the seat stands now.

Finished 2nd of 6 with 14,179 votes (31.3%).

The result in full · 2015 General Election

CandidatePartyVotesShare
Stephen Gethins✓ electedSNP18,52340.9%
Tim BrettLD14,17931.3%
Huw BellCon7,37316.3%
Brian ThomsonLab3,4767.7%
Andy CollinsGreen1,3873.1%
Mike Scott-HaywardInd3250.7%

Majority 4,344 · 45,263 votes cast.
